How to Enhance Your English Skills as a Mandarin Learner: Effective Strategies182
Embarking on the path of language acquisition can be both rewarding and challenging. As a Mandarin learner, you may seek to expand your horizons by acquiring proficiency in English. While this endeavor may seem daunting, there are effective strategies you can employ to enhance your English skills and achieve your language goals. Here's a comprehensive guide to help you navigate the learning process effectively:
1. Immerse Yourself in English Content
Immersion plays a pivotal role in language learning. Surround yourself with English content to increase your exposure to the language and improve your comprehension. Read books, watch movies, listen to music, and engage in conversations with native speakers or language partners. The more you interact with English, the more comfortable you will become with its nuances and complexities.
2. Focus on Vocabulary Building
A strong vocabulary is the foundation of effective communication. Start by learning essential words and phrases that you can use in everyday situations. Use flashcards, apps, or online resources to expand your vocabulary gradually. Pay attention to the context in which words are used to understand their meanings more clearly. Regularly reviewing and practicing new vocabulary will help you retain them.
3. Practice Speaking and Listening
Speaking and listening are crucial skills for language proficiency. Find opportunities to practice speaking English by joining conversation groups, taking online classes, or hiring a tutor. Focus on expressing yourself clearly and confidently. Listen attentively to native English speakers to improve your comprehension and pronunciation. Repeat what you hear to practice your speaking skills.
4. Study Grammar and Sentence Structure
Understanding the underlying grammar and sentence structure of English will help you construct sentences correctly and communicate effectively. Study the parts of speech, tenses, and sentence patterns. Practice writing short sentences and gradually increase the complexity of your writing. Seek feedback from native speakers or language teachers to improve your grammatical accuracy.
5. Leverage Technology
Technology can be a valuable tool for language learning. Utilize language learning apps, online dictionaries, and translation tools to enhance your vocabulary and grammar. Explore websites and podcasts that provide English lessons and resources tailored to Mandarin learners. By incorporating technology into your learning routine, you can make the process more engaging and efficient.
6. Set Realistic Goals
Setting realistic language learning goals is crucial for staying motivated. Avoid overwhelming yourself with ambitious targets. Start with small, achievable goals and gradually increase the difficulty as you progress. Breaking down larger goals into smaller steps can make the learning process less daunting and more manageable.
7. Find a Language Exchange Partner
Finding a language exchange partner can provide you with a valuable opportunity to practice speaking and listening. Connect with native English speakers who are interested in learning Mandarin. Engage in regular conversations, where you can exchange language skills and gain insights into cultural differences.
8. Be Patient and Consistent
Language learning requires patience and consistency. Don't get discouraged by setbacks or slow progress. Focus on making gradual improvements over time. Regular practice, even in short intervals, can lead to significant progress in the long run. Celebrate your successes and use them as motivation to continue your learning journey.
Remember, learning English as a Mandarin learner is a challenging but rewarding endeavor. By embracing these strategies, immersing yourself in the language, and practicing consistently, you can unlock the doors to effective English communication and expand your linguistic horizons.
